The Core Concept: Nutrient Balance and Health

Nutritional status represents the condition of a person's health influenced by their intake, absorption, and use of nutrients. It is a dynamic state reflecting diet, physiology, and environment. Essentially, it indicates how well the body is nourished to support vital functions like growth, immune defense, and energy production.

Understanding the Bidirectional Relationship

Assessing nutritional status is vital due to the bidirectional relationship between nutrition and health. Good nutrition provides building blocks for cellular function and a strong immune system. Poor nutrition can lead to growth issues in children and increased chronic disease risk in adults. Conversely, health conditions like gastrointestinal disorders or critical illness can impair nutrient absorption or increase metabolic needs, affecting nutritional status.

Comprehensive Nutritional Assessment Methods

Healthcare professionals use a multi-dimensional approach for accurate nutritional assessment, as a single measurement is often insufficient.

Anthropometric Measurements

These are objective physical measurements of body size and composition. Examples include height and weight (used for BMI and growth charts), BMI (weight relative to height), waist and hip circumferences (fat distribution), and Mid-Upper Arm Circumference (MUAC) for muscle and fat stores.

Biochemical and Clinical Evaluations

These methods assess nutrient levels and physical signs. Biochemical tests on blood and urine measure specific nutrients like iron or vitamin D, or proteins indicating nutritional status. Clinical examination involves checking for visible signs of imbalances like dry skin or brittle hair.

Dietary and Functional Analysis

These evaluate food intake and its impact on performance. Dietary evaluations use tools like food diaries to analyze intake patterns. Functional assessment checks how nutrition affects physical performance, such as grip strength.

What Different Nutritional Statuses Indicate

Nutritional status ranges across a spectrum.

Optimal Nutritional Status

This indicates nutrient intake meets requirements for growth, maintenance, and function, suggesting a strong immune system, healthy weight, and resilience.

Malnutrition: Undernutrition and Overnutrition

Malnutrition includes both deficiencies (undernutrition) and excesses (overnutrition).

  • Undernutrition: Insufficient energy or nutrient intake, leading to issues like stunting or wasting in children, and weight loss or increased infection risk in adults.
  • Overnutrition: Chronic surplus intake, often calories, leading to overweight or obesity and conditions like diabetes. Individuals can be overweight but still lack micronutrients due to poor diet.

Comparison of Assessment Methods

Method Category Examples Indicates Timeframe Limitations
Anthropometric Weight, Height, BMI, MUAC Body size, fat distribution, muscle mass Long-term (chronic issues) Doesn't differentiate muscle vs. fat; insensitive to micronutrient issues
Biochemical Serum Albumin, Iron Levels Specific nutrient levels, protein status Short-term (acute issues) Can be affected by hydration, inflammation, and non-nutritional factors
Clinical Physical exam for skin, hair, mouth Visible signs of deficiencies Long-term (advanced issues) Only detects late-stage problems; signs are not always specific
Dietary 24-hour recall, food diary Nutrient intake and dietary habits Short-term (recent intake) Depends on recall accuracy; potential for under/over-reporting

Factors Influencing Your Nutritional Status

Various factors beyond diet impact nutritional status.

Physiological Factors

Nutrient needs change with age, sex, growth, pregnancy, and lactation. Aging can reduce energy needs, appetite, and nutrient absorption.

Pathological Conditions

Diseases like cancer or inflammatory bowel disease increase metabolic demands or cause malabsorption. Infections also raise energy needs.

Socioeconomic and Lifestyle Elements

Access to healthy food is linked to socioeconomic status. Food insecurity impacts diet quality. Lifestyle factors like activity level, stress, and substance use affect nutrient needs and absorption.

The Critical Importance of Assessment

Nutritional assessment is key in the nutrition care process. It identifies imbalances, diagnoses malnutrition, and guides interventions. Early detection of subclinical deficiencies prevents complications and improves quality of life. Assessment before surgery can reduce complications. In public health, it identifies vulnerable groups and informs policy.
